The Shoe Dryer Market grew from USD 236.08 million in 2025 to USD 254.71 million in 2026. It is expected to continue growing at a CAGR of 7.66%, reaching USD 395.92 million by 2032.

Comprehensive segmentation insights detailing how power sources, end-user needs, distribution channels, heating technologies, product forms, and mount types determine product design priorities

A granular segmentation perspective clarifies where product requirements, channel behaviors, and purchasing priorities diverge, guiding differentiated go-to-market playbooks. When viewed by power source, offerings range from battery-powered units that emphasize portability to electric solutions that deliver consistent performance, with electric divided into alternating current and direct current implementations; solar-powered designs are increasingly explored for off-grid or eco-focused scenarios. By end user, the market separates commercial buyers who prioritize durability and serviceability - with hospitality and industrial subsegments seeking scaled reliability - from residential consumers who value convenience, aesthetics, and compact footprints.

Distribution channel dynamics influence buying patterns: offline stores encompass specialty retailers and supermarket/hypermarket formats where hands-on inspection and immediate availability remain important, while online channels include both company websites, which support brand storytelling and bundled offerings, and third-party platforms that broaden reach and enable rapid price comparison. Heating technology presents distinct functional trade-offs: forced air systems deliver rapid drying for activewear, infrared options - including far infrared and near infrared variants - offer fabric-friendly, hygiene-oriented performance, and UV modalities focus on disinfection as a primary value proposition. Product type segmentation differentiates boot dryers, combination systems, shoe rack designs, and shoe tree configurations, each addressing unique size, airflow, and convenience requirements. Mount type further refines application and aesthetic fit, spanning free-standing units for versatility, tabletop models for compact spaces, and wall-mounted installations for permanent, space-saving solutions.

Taken together, these segment dimensions inform product roadmaps, pricing strategies, and channel prioritization. Manufacturers that align heating technology to end-user expectations and select distribution pathways that complement product ergonomics and service models can capture higher lifetime value and reduce returns. Furthermore, modular product platforms that can be configured across power, heating, and mount permutations may unlock cost efficiencies while accelerating time to market for targeted customer cohorts.

How regional consumer preferences, regulatory regimes, and distribution ecosystems across the Americas, Europe Middle East & Africa, and Asia-Pacific shape product strategy and market entry choices

Regional dynamics shape demand patterns, regulatory considerations, and distribution choices in meaningful ways across the Americas, Europe, Middle East & Africa, and Asia-Pacific. In the Americas, consumer emphasis on convenience, outdoor recreation, and cold-weather performance supports a mix of portable battery solutions, robust combination units, and retail channel diversity that includes large-format retailers and dedicated specialty outlets. Meanwhile, Europe, Middle East & Africa presents a heterogeneous landscape where energy efficiency standards, hospitality sector preferences, and varying climates result in differentiated product requirements; urban households often favor compact tabletop or wall-mounted models, whereas commercial facilities require scalable, serviceable units.

In the Asia-Pacific region, manufacturing density, rapid urbanization, and a strong e-commerce ecosystem accelerate innovation cycles and price competition. This region also features a wide spectrum of consumer affordability and rising interest in hygiene-focused technologies, which influences demand for infrared and UV options as well as affordable, combination-style products. Across regions, regulatory frameworks for appliance safety and electromagnetic compliance impose design and certification considerations that affect component selection and time to market. Additionally, regional logistics and distribution infrastructures influence inventory strategies and channel mixes; for example, areas with mature third-party platform adoption enable brands to test new configurations with minimal retail footprint, while regions with established offline specialty retail continue to favor tactile customer experiences.

Successful market participants calibrate product assortments and certification processes to match regional priorities, leveraging localized marketing, after-sales networks, and partnerships with distribution nodes that can deliver both reach and service reliability.
